What is Luxury Vinyl Plank Flooring?


Luxury vinyl plank flooring is a type of vinyl flooring that mimics the look of hardwood or stone but is more affordable and more accessible to maintain. Made of multiple layers, LVP is designed to be highly durable and resistant to water, stains, and scratches. The surface layer features a high-resolution image replicating the texture and grain of natural materials, giving it an authentic appearance.
 

Why Choose Luxury Vinyl Plank?


Durability: LVP is constructed to withstand heavy traffic, making it perfect for families, pets, and high-traffic areas.

Water Resistance: Many luxury vinyl plank options are waterproof, making them suitable for kitchens, bathrooms, and basements where moisture concerns them.

Easy Maintenance: Unlike hardwood, LVP doesn’t require frequent refinishing or sealing. Regular sweeping and occasional mopping are enough to keep it looking fresh.

Realistic Appearance: Thanks to advanced printing technology, luxury vinyl plank flooring can replicate the appearance of various wood species or stone types, providing a high-end look without the price.
 

Luxury Vinyl Tile (LVT) vs. Luxury Vinyl Plank


Both luxury vinyl plank and luxury vinyl tile (LVT) are variations of luxury vinyl flooring, but they differ in appearance and application. While LVP mimics wood planks, LVT is designed to resemble ceramic or stone tiles. LVT is available in various patterns, making it a fantastic choice for areas where you want the look of stone or tile without maintenance.
 

Installation Options


LVP flooring can be installed using several methods:

Floating Floor: The planks click together and “float” over the subfloor, making installation simple and mess-free.

Glue-Down: A glue-down installation provides extra stability for areas prone to high traffic.

Peel-and-Stick: Although less common, peel-and-stick options are available for a DIY-friendly installation.
